概述:
阿里云RDS是阿里巴巴提供的一款稳定、可靠、高性能的数据库服务。这款服务支持多种主流数据库引擎,如MySQL、SQL Server和PostgreSQL等。RDS致力于为企业级应用提供一系列优势,包括但不限于弹性伸缩、高可用性、安全防护和简单易用等。这些优势使得用户能够轻松地构建数据驱动的应用。
引言:阿里云RDS服务简介与优势
阿里云的关系型数据库服务(RDS)是基于盘古分布式文件系统和飞天分布式计算平台的强大产品,旨在为企业提供稳定、可靠、高性能的解决方案。RDS支持多种数据库引擎,并具备以下显著优势:
1. 弹性伸缩:根据实际需求动态调整资源,实现成本优化。
2. 高可用性:通过主备实例和只读实例的设计,实现故障自动切换,确保业务连续性。
3. 安全防护:提供数据加密、安全组、SSL加密等多种安全措施,全方位保护数据安全。
4. 简单易用:通过控制台或API进行管理,大大简化运维操作。
阿里云账号与服务市场:
第一步,注册阿里云账号。访问阿里云官网(
购买RDS实例:
在创建项目后,通过阿里云控制台购买RDS实例。进入控制台的RDS服务页面,选择所需的数据库引擎、版本、实例类型(如单实例、主备实例)及配置参数(如内存、存储空间)。填写实例名称、所属项目、安全组等信息,根据需要选择是否开启实例备份、日志记录等功能。确认购买信息无误后,完成支付流程。
创建与配置RDS实例:
选择合适的实例类型和配置参数是至关重要的。您可以选择单实例、主备实例或只读实例。在配置参数时,需要考虑性能需求、成本和业务负载,以确保应用性能。例如,一个MySQL实例的配置可能包括实例类型、引擎、版本、实例规格、存储空间、网络类型、安全及备份设置等。
连接与管理数据库:
连接和管理数据库可以通过阿里云控制台和命令行工具完成。通过控制台,您可以获取连接字符串,使用数据库管理工具或客户端工具连接RDS实例。您还可以进行数据库管理,如执行SQL语句、创建数据库表和管理用户权限等。RDS提供了自动备份功能,并允许手动创建快照,以便在出现问题时恢复数据。还需要配置安全组和访问控制,确保只有授权的IP或CIDR能够访问RDS实例,并管理实例的访问权限。
日常维护与优化:
为了保持RDS实例的性能和稳定性,日常的监控与优化工作至关重要。使用阿里云监控服务(CloudMonitor)监控实例的性能指标,如CPU使用率、内存使用率、IOPS等。根据监控数据,可以调整资源分配,实现性能优化。应对措施包括水平扩展(增加只读实例或读写分离)和垂直扩展(增加实例规格)。优化业务逻辑和SQL查询也是减少资源消耗的有效途径。面对性能问题或数据丢失等常见故障,可以通过监控数据定位问题,并采取相应的优化和恢复措施。异常中断:网络、存储与实例状态的全方位检查
在面对异常中断这一挑战时,我们需要对网络、存储以及实例状态进行全面的检查,确保每一个环节都运行正常。及时应对和处理故障点,是保障系统稳定运行的关键。
结语与实践建议:从实践中总结经验
为了有效应对异常中断,我们需要总结关键点,选择合适的实例类型和配置参数。借助阿里云监控服务,我们可以对系统进行性能监控,并获取故障预警。定期备份数据是防止数据丢失的重要措施。在数据库优化方面,采用最佳实践如查询优化、合理使用索引等,能够显著提升数据库性能。
实际案例分享:电商与游戏公司的成功实践
案例1:某电商网站在使用阿里云RDS后,对数据库结构进行了调整,并对查询语句进行了优化。这一举措将数据库的响应时间从1秒缩短至0.3秒,极大地提升了用户体验,为网站的运营提供了强大的支持。
案例2:一家游戏公司面临着高并发处理的挑战。通过增加只读实例实现读写分离,该公司成功地提高了游戏的并发处理能力,大幅减少了用户的等待时间,为玩家带来了更流畅的游戏体验。
后续学习资源推荐:持续学习与进步
慕课网:提供丰富的数据库管理、SQL查询、大数据处理等技术课程,是你不间断学习的理想平台。
阿里云官方文档:提供详细的RDS使用指南和API参考,帮助你更深入地了解和使用阿里云产品。
社区论坛:与同行交流经验,共同探讨解决问题的方法和策略,相互学习,共同成长。
文章来自《钓虾网小编|www.jnqjk.cn》整理于网络,文章内容不代表本站立场,转载请注明出处。